Listen up, y’all.
I don’t have to tell you that using specific numbers and metrics is KEY when it comes to making your resume stand out.
But if every time you try to think of those details - like percentages or measurable results - you want to throw your hands up and forget the whole thing…you’re not alone. Nurses have enough to juggle without tracking numbers during every shift!
The thing is, when it comes to delivering excellent care, collaborating with your team, and improving patient outcomes, you’ve already got it DOWN.
You’re already playing a huge role in quality improvement projects, like reducing central line infections on your unit.
You mentor new nurses and help them transition to confident, independent practice.
And you work closely with case managers to create discharge plans that lower readmission rates.
So…why are you still struggling to showcase those wins in a way that makes your resume pop?
Here’s the truth: your work is already being tracked somewhere - you just need to ask for it, and your performance reviews are an easy place to start! Whether it’s infection rates, retention percentages, or patient satisfaction scores, those numbers can set your resume apart.
And even if you can’t find the exact stats, you can still use action words like “increased,” “decreased,” or “improved” to highlight your impact—way more effective than simply listing duties.
So here’s your starting point:
1️⃣ Ask your manager for feedback and metrics from your review. [SAVE it]
2️⃣ Write down examples of your work, using specifics wherever possible. [Use a Google Sheet tracker]
3️⃣ Keep your resume updated as you go - you’re doing incredible work, and it deserves to shine!

You’re not the only one feeling stuck trying to break into remote Utilization Review (UR) nursing, trust me!
Here’s what actually works ⤵️
✔️Use your clinical judgment skills to show you can evaluate care decisions
✔️Emphasize any experience with chart reviews
✔️Mention working with MCG or InterQual if you’ve done it (or learn the basics online)
✔️Apply fast…these jobs fill up quicker than you think!
✔️Get ready to explain your critical thinking during interviews…practice telling your story!

🤐Pssst: I’ve noticed so many jobs requesting experience with Interqual or MCG/Milliman guidelines for UM/UR jobs.
If you do not have this kind of experience, you can enroll in the Case Management Institute’s Utilization Management & MCG course. After passing that course, you are eligible to take the MCG certification exam!
